Output d90a052d29a500e72ab9c3efb023dc3eecb4c32c79f15600a511dbbd0041f1ff:0

value
143683167
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e170fc81d9da6fcbdf9106b468f38d673192cbc OP_EQUALVERIFY OP_CHECKSIG
address
12HW639NCLsPfXLNux6KW9v2sBzxhHrBN5
transaction
d90a052d29a500e72ab9c3efb023dc3eecb4c32c79f15600a511dbbd0041f1ff
confirmations
506589
spent
true